Transaction 2371c80591491eb39e65e5003509b1354aed30be923c1cad5c25814e37ee47e0

10 Input
2 Outputs
  • 2371c80591491eb39e65e5003509b1354aed30be923c1cad5c25814e37ee47e0:0
  • value  150000
    address  3PtJLz9fTcF6Gzb9LoRJh4KLNxe4SgaiEF
  • 2371c80591491eb39e65e5003509b1354aed30be923c1cad5c25814e37ee47e0:1
  • value  19060318
    address  bc1q9p0h7xsvh7c0nscz4lxgr6jf0umnf4uzu530h8